BHU scientist to do research on cost-effective anti-diabetic drugs

Varanasi: A scientist of

medicinal chemistry

at the Banaras Hindu University Dr Nazar Hussain has bagged a project of SERB-DST to carry out research on the cost-effective anti-diabetic drugs by new routes. The study will explore the possibilities of combining polyphenols with carbohydrates to test anti-viral activities.
According to the BHU authorities, Dr Nazar Hussain, assistant professor, department of Medicinal Chemistry,

Institute of Medical Sciences

, BHU will carry out the research on C-glycosides synthesis.
Dr Hussain said that C-glycosides are the derivatives of carbohydrates which are widely used in the treatment of diabetes. He will get a grant of over Rs 40 lakh for his research. Along with the synthesis of anti-diabetic drugs the project also aims at synthesizing some polyphenolic C- glycosides. Polyphenolic compounds are known in the treatment of various viral infections.
The study will also explore the possibility of combining polyphenols with carbohydrates to test their anti-viral activities against different viral infections including

Covid

, he said adding, this will be one of the major studies of its kind in the country.
